AirCraft Spray Gun 1.4mm Nozzle HVLP Gravity Feed Viper Series (SG AC2000-02VP)

At a Glance: Viper Series HVLP gravity feed spray gun with a 1.4mm nozzleâ"versatile flow for topcoats, clears and general finishing.

If you want one nozzle size that covers a lot of real-world spraying jobs, 1.4mm is the classic workhorse. The AirCraft SG AC2000-02VP Viper Series Spray Gun combines HVLP efficiency with a gravity feed design and a 1.4mm nozzleâ"ideal for smooth topcoats and general finishing where you want consistent atomisation with enough flow to keep productivity up. HVLP helps reduce overspray and improve transfer efficiency, meaning more paint goes onto the surface and less ends up floating around your workshop. The result: cleaner work, better control and a finish that looks like you meant it.

Versatile HVLP Finishing Control: a 1.4mm gravity feed spray gun made for clean, even coats

The 1.4mm nozzle size is widely used for topcoats and general-purpose finishing, balancing smooth atomisation with practical material flow. Gravity feed supports steady delivery, and HVLP helps keep overspray down while improving transfer efficiency.


DescriptionSpecification
BrandAirCraft
Cat No.SG AC2000-02VP
Product TypeHVLP Gravity Feed Spray Gun
SeriesViper Series
Packaging TypeColored cardboard box
Package Dimensions225(L) x 150(W) x 130(H)mm
Package Weight820g
Tool Weight540g
MaterialBody :Aluminium
Nozzle cap: Aluminium & Brass
FinishBlack Teflon surface and blue anodized knob.
Standard Nozzle1.4mm
Optimal pressure3.5bar/50PSI
Maximum pressure4.0Bar/58PSI
Air consumption11-13cfm
Pattern width240-270mm
Spray distance200mm
Cup capacity600ml
Content1 x Spray Gun
1 x Cup
1 x Multi-purpose wrench
1 x Nylon brush
1 x Filter
1 x Spanner socket

Extra Information

  • For best results, strain paint and adjust viscosity to suit the productmaterial prep is half the finish.
  • Always test spray on cardboard and tune fan, fluid and pressure before the real job.

Pro Tip

  • Keep your gun distance and speed consistent. If you see dry edges, increase fluid slightly or slow down; if you see runs, reduce fluid or speed uptiny adjustments beat big guesses every time.

Safety

  • Wear eye protection and a respirator suitable for paint mistespecially with solvent-based coatings.
  • Spray in a well-ventilated area or spray booth to reduce inhalation and overspray build-up.
  • Keep paints and thinners away from heat, flames and sparksmany are flammable.
  • Disconnect from the air supply before servicing and clean the gun after use to prevent blockages.
